Block

#21,664,787
Block Number
21,664,787 @ 05/13/2025, 22:57:20
Status
Finalized
ID
0x014a9413335c54b68b0ce79352ba6a7cf265058df73e73721172e5df8816c2ce
Transactions
Gas Used
3436705/40000000 (8.59% Used)
Total Score
2,115,811,558 (+99)
Rewards
13.44 VTHO